For your safety
■ Testing the alarm function
You can trigger a predefined test alarm to check whether the phone signals the alarms to the
alarm system and whether the system recognises the alarm signals and processes them.
This function is only available with an ATASpro licence. Contact your system administrator for
more information.
■ Range alarm
The phone can only send the alarm messages if it is within the radio area. So it is important to

When the alarm server mode is activated, an alarm is triggered as soon as the battery is below
20 %.
Note:
Always trigger a test alarm when you begin your shift to check that the alarm system is operational.
Repeat the test at regular intervals.
Press the navigation key to the right or the
Menu
softkey.
Settings
Scroll to
Settings
and press the
Select
softkey.
Sensor alarm
Scroll to
Sensor alarm
and press the
Select
softkey.
Transmit test alarm
Scroll to
Transmit test alarm
and press the
Select
softkey.
➔
Test alarm is sent to the alarm system. Depending on the configuration of
the alarm system, the alarm system triggers a test alarm and signals it on
your phone.
